Exploring AI: A Hands-On Guide to Understanding Artificial Intelligence
Artificial intelligence has become a pervasive force in our world. From self-driving vehicles to advanced algorithms that power our daily interactions, AI is rapidly reshaping the landscape of our reality. However, for many, AI remains an enigmatic and complex concept. This article aims to clarify AI by providing a practical guide to understanding its basic principles.
First, let's explain what AI truly represents. At its heart, AI refers to the capacity of machines to replicate human intelligence. This includes activities such as learning, reasoning, and understanding sensory input.
- Machine learning, a key subfield of AI, enables systems to learn from data without explicit programming.
- Deep learning, a more advanced form of machine learning, utilizes artificial neural networks to process information in a layered manner.

Python for AI Developers: Mastering the Language of Machine Learning
In the dynamic realm in artificial intelligence engineering, Python has firmly established itself as the leading language. Its adaptability and extensive libraries, especially in the realm in machine learning, have made it an indispensable tool for AI developers. Python's elegant syntax promotes rapid prototyping and deployment, while its thriving community provides ample support and resources.
From fundamental concepts like data processing to complex algorithms for classification, Python equips developers with the necessary tools to develop intelligent applications. Whether you're exploring deep learning, natural language processing, or computer vision, Python's features empower you to bring your AI visions to life.
